What You're Getting

The Signa S4 packs a 7-driver array with dedicated full-range center channel for clear dialog and up-firing speakers that bounce Dolby Atmos height channels off the ceiling for overhead sound effects. Polk's VoiceAdjust technology lets you dial up vocal clarity without touching overall volume, and BassAdjust gives you control over the wireless subwoofer's punch.

Setup is a single HDMI eARC cable, it works with 8K, 4K, and HD TVs, and the ultra-slim profile (just 2.36 inches tall) fits under most screens without blocking the IR sensor or bottom edge.

Who This Is For

Best for anyone stuck with tinny TV speakers who wants real surround sound without running wires across the room. The wireless sub and one-cable hookup make this a 5-minute upgrade for living rooms, bedrooms, or apartments.

Skip it if you need a full 5.1.4 Atmos system with rear satellites -- this is a 3.1.2 setup, not a full home theater rig.

The Caveat

The 5.9-inch wireless subwoofer delivers solid bass for music and movies, but it won't shake the walls like a larger 10-inch or 12-inch sub. If deep, room-rattling low end is a priority, look at the Signa S4's bigger siblings.
